Dr. Ahmed M. Raslan is a pioneering neurosurgeon and researcher whose work sits at the intersection of advanced surgical robotics, epilepsy surgery, and precision neuromodulation. His most-cited research, including the 2022 study on the "Stealth Autoguide for robotic-assisted laser ablation," demonstrates his commitment to enhancing the accuracy and safety of minimally invasive brain surgery. Dr. Raslan has been instrumental in developing and validating robotic-assisted platforms for laser interstitial thermal therapy (LITT), a transformative technique for treating lesional epilepsy and brain tumors. His contributions have helped establish a new standard of care, reducing patient morbidity while maximizing therapeutic impact. With over a decade of clinical and translational work, his studies consistently push the boundaries of stereotactic navigation and robotic integration in the operating room.
